Abstract
The utility model relates to the technical field of electric power, and discloses a control device for electric power transmission, which comprises a control cabinet, wherein an installation mechanism is arranged in the control cabinet, the installation mechanism comprises a vertically arranged threaded rod, a plurality of mounting plates are sleeved on the threaded rod, the upper end of the threaded rod is rotatably connected with an upper mounting plate, the upper mounting plate is fixed with the upper wall of the control cabinet, the lower end of the threaded rod is rotatably connected with a lower mounting plate, the lower mounting plate is fixed with the bottom surface of the control cabinet, a rotating lantern ring is arranged below the mounting plates, the control device for electric power transmission is characterized in that the threaded rod is sleeved with a plurality of mounting plates, the design improves the space utilization rate in the control cabinet, further reduces the volume of the control cabinet, is convenient to transport, and the mounting plates can rotate along with the threaded rod, so that electric devices on the inner side can be rotated to the outside during maintenance, thereby facilitating the maintenance.

Background
The control cabinet is formed by assembling switch equipment, measuring instruments, protective electrical appliances and auxiliary equipment in a closed or semi-closed metal cabinet or on a screen according to the electrical wiring requirements, and the arrangement of the control cabinet meets the requirements of normal operation of an electric power system.

In the figure: the device comprises a control cabinet 1, a mounting mechanism 2, a mounting plate 3, a threaded rod 4, an upper mounting plate 5, a lower mounting plate 6, a limiting lug 7, a strip-shaped limiting groove 8 and a rotating lantern ring 9.
Detailed Description
The technical solutions in the embodiments of the present invention will be described clearly and completely with reference to the accompanying drawings in the embodiments of the present invention, and it is obvious that the described embodiments are only some embodiments of the present invention, not all embodiments.
In the description of the present invention, it is to be understood that the terms "upper", "lower", "front", "rear", "left", "right", "top", "bottom", "inner", "outer", and the like indicate orientations or positional relationships based on the orientations or positional relationships shown in the drawings, and are only for convenience of description and simplicity of description, and do not indicate or imply that the device or element being referred to must have a particular orientation, be constructed and operated in a particular orientation, and therefore, should not be construed as limiting the present invention.
Referring to fig. 1-4, a control device for power transmission comprises a control cabinet 1, wherein an installation mechanism 2 is arranged in the control cabinet 1, the installation mechanism 2 comprises a vertically arranged threaded rod 4, a plurality of mounting plates 3 are sleeved on the threaded rod 4, an upper mounting plate 5 is rotatably connected to the upper end of the threaded rod 4, the upper mounting plate 5 is fixed to the upper wall of the control cabinet 1, a lower mounting plate 6 is rotatably connected to the lower end of the threaded rod 4, the lower mounting plate 6 is fixed to the bottom surface of the control cabinet 1, a rotating sleeve ring 9 is arranged below the mounting plates 3, and the rotating sleeve ring 9 is in threaded connection with the threaded rod 4.

As a further aspect of the present invention, the number of the mounting plates 3 is plural, and the plurality of mounting plates 3 are arranged at equal intervals from top to bottom.
As the utility model discloses a further scheme, the jack internal diameter of seting up on the mounting panel 3 is greater than the diameter of threaded rod 4, and mounting panel 3 and 4 sliding connection of threaded rod guarantee that mounting panel 3 can move on threaded rod 4.
